Meatballs that I came up with the other night. I made spaghetti and I wanted to make some meatballs. So I decided to make some and I just threw some stuff together and they turned out really tasty. Add to whatever dish you desire!
Ready in: 35 mins

Ingredients

Serves: 6
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 1 teaspoon garlic salt
  • 2 tablespoon cornstarch
  • 1/2 cup mozzarella cheese
  • 1 pound regular sausage
  • 1/2 stack round crackers

Preparation method

Prep: 15 mins | Cook: 20 mins

1.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
2. Mix the milk, eggs, cinnamon, garlic salt, cornstarch, mozzarella, sausage, and crackers with hands making sure all ingredients are mixed together.
3. Take the mixture and make little balls. Place balls on a greased cookie sheet. Space the balls evenly apart.
4. Bake in the preheated oven directly in the center until golden brown, 15 to 20 minutes.
